The "Cabin Air Filter": The Invisible Health Hazard
A neglected cabin filter can spread mold, weaken defrosting, and harm your car’s blower motor.
Most car owners treat the cabin air filter as an optional accessory, often completely forgetting it exists until the air coming through the vents begins to smell "musty" or "damp." By that time, the filter isn"t just dirty—it has become a breeding ground for biological contaminants that you and your passengers are inhaling every time you turn on the fan.
It is not just a dust collector; it is the primary shield for your respiratory health inside the vehicle.
1. The "Biological Petri Dish"
Unlike the engine air filter, which deals with dry dust and soot, the cabin air filter is frequently exposed to moisture.

The Trap: When you turn off your A/C, the evaporator core remains wet, creating a dark, humid environment right behind your dashboard. This moisture is pulled through the cabin air filter.

The Result: The filter becomes a damp, nutrient-rich surface for mold, mildew, and bacteria. You are not just breathing recycled air; you are breathing a concentrated stream of airborne spores and fungi.
2. The "Blower Motor" Killer
The cabin air filter is usually positioned directly before the blower motor (the fan that pushes air into the cabin).

The Problem: As the filter clogs with dust, dead leaves, and debris, it restricts airflow.

The Consequence: The blower motor has to work significantly harder to push air through the dense, clogged material. This increases the electrical load and restricts the cooling airflow that the fan motor needs to prevent its own internal coils from overheating.

The Cost: A cabin air filter costs $15–$30. A blower motor replacement can cost $200–$500. Ignoring the filter is a classic case of penny-wise, pound-foolish maintenance.
3. The "Defrost" Deterioration
Your cabin air filter is a vital part of your defrosting system.

The Reality: If the filter is clogged, the airflow hitting your windshield is significantly weaker. In humid or rainy conditions, this means your car will take much longer to clear fogged glass, drastically reducing your visibility and safety.
4. The "Scent" Warning
Drivers often use air fresheners to mask the "musty" smell of a clogged filter.

The Danger: This is purely cosmetic. The smell is the result of bacterial growth. Masking the scent does nothing to stop the health hazard. If you detect a "dirty sock" smell, the filter is likely already saturated with mold.
5. When to Change (It"s Not Just About Kilometers)
Manufacturers often suggest changing the filter every 20,000 km, but that is a generalized estimate. Your specific environment matters much more.

The Climate Test: If you live in a humid, coastal, or heavily forested area, moisture and organic debris (pollen, leaves) will clog and contaminate the filter much faster.

The Rule of Thumb: Change it at least once a year, preferably in the spring after the heavy pollen season has passed. If you drive in high-traffic, urban environments, change it every 6 months to filter out diesel soot and fine particulate matter.
The Expert’s Advice: Upgrade to "Activated Carbon"

Skip the Basic Paper Filter: When you buy a replacement, opt for an "activated carbon" or "HEPA" cabin filter. These include a layer of charcoal that actively adsorbs odors, exhaust fumes, and harmful gases from the outside air. They are well worth the small extra cost.

Inspect the Housing: When you pull the old filter out, use a small vacuum or a damp cloth to wipe out the housing before installing the new one. This ensures you aren"t leaving behind trapped debris that will immediately contaminate your new filter.

Check for Rodents: In some vehicles, the cabin filter is the only thing standing between the interior of your car and a curious mouse. If you see nesting material (bits of paper, insulation, or fur) on top of your old filter, you have a pest problem that needs to be addressed immediately.
